Amino-Acid Restrictions Linked to Longer Healthy Lifespan, Review Finds

TL;DR Summary
A comprehensive review of over 350 studies finds that lowering total dietary protein or restricting specific essential amino acids—especially isoleucine and methionine—may promote longevity and better metabolic health by activating repair pathways (FGF21, autophagy) and dampening growth signals (mTORC1, GCN2). Benefits observed in animals and some human data; however, protein needs vary with age and activity, and excessive restriction could harm older adults by raising sarcopenia risk. The authors stress optimizing amino-acid balance rather than simply eating less protein, and more human research is needed.
